Massive Rally in Dhaka Against Israeli Actions

On April 12, 2025, Dhaka witnessed one of the largest pro-Palestinian demonstrations in its history, as approximately 100,000 people gathered at Suhrawardy Park near Dhaka University to protest against Israel's military actions in the Gaza Strip .​AP News






A Unified Voice for Gaza

The rally, dubbed the "March for Gaza," was marked by a sea of Palestinian flags and chants of "Free, Free Palestine." Protesters carried symbolic coffins and effigies representing civilian casualties in Gaza, expressing solidarity with Palestinians and condemning the violence .​The Times of Israel+1AP News+1AP News


Political and Religious Solidarity

The demonstration received backing from various political and religious groups, including the Bangladesh Nationalist Party, led by former Prime Minister Khaleda Zia, and several Islamist organizations . Bangladesh, a Muslim-majority nation with a population of 170 million, does not have diplomatic relations with Israel and officially supports an independent Palestinian state.AP News


A Broader Movement

In addition to the rally, reports indicate that over one million Bangladeshis have pledged to boycott products and entities linked to Israel, highlighting a nationwide movement in support of Palestine .​Arab News
